SubjectRe: 2.2.10 won't boot w/o keyboard
>> Can you build 2.2.10 with the 2.2.9 arch/i386/boot/setup.S

> I did, and it boots fine.

In that case one might conjecture that the code to switch A20 on
failed because empty_8042 returns too early.
That would explain a hang (namely in a20_wait).

Right now we use 2^16 loops in empty_8042.
Since we waited infinitely long in 2.2.9, there cannot be a problem
increasing this number.

Still - surprising that 2^16 would not suffice.
